UPDATE:

The swap is complete! The power and drivability have far, far, far exceeded my expectations. One major, unintended benefit that no one talks about is how much better the steering feels and responds with the GM power steering pump and getting the weight off the front end (I’m running an 80-series steering box). The swap completely transformed the FJ, and I recommend it to anyone even considering doing it.

Details:

2018 L96 6.0 with 31k miles on it, new H55, and split case.
